Is the beeping of arriving emails keeping you up at night? Sure, you could always mute it but then you might miss that important phone call. Sound Profiles are the answer. From the Jump Screen press the Menu button, select Settings then Sound Profiles. From there, you can crank up, turn down or entirely disable different sounds. Once you have a setup you like, give it a catchy name, save the profile and switch to it whenever you need a bit of silence.

Trying to grab a fast picture with your Danger-powered device? Forget rolling the trackball! From anywhere on the jump screen, a quick press of the top-right bumper will take you to the Camera app, another press will power-up your camera, and a final press will take the picture. Click click click done!

When you are setting individual ringtones for the contacts you want to hear from the most, don't forget to set some for the people you want to avoid most of the time. This way, you'll know the instant your Danger-powered device rings whether you should answer the phone or leave it in your pocket.
Get your music going! Connect your Sidekick 3 to your computer with the included USB cable, or remove the SD card (hint: it is under the back cover) and put it into your external card reader. Drag MP3 files to the Music folder on the card. Unhook, or get the card back into your Sidekick. Press the Jump button and Done button simultaneously to quick-launch Music Player.
Go wireless with Bluetooth and make that important hands-free call you've been waiting on. First tip - make sure your headset is on and "visible". Second tip: turn Bluetooth on! From the Jump screen, press Menu and go to Bluetooth. Turn it on, then select Pairings. Select your headset from the list. That's it! From the Phone, press Menu and transfer the sound to your headset and you are good to go.
